Background of Hedera

Hedera Hashgraph is a distributed ledger technology (DLT) platform that differentiates itself from traditional blockchain systems. Instead of using a blockchain, Hedera employs a directed acyclic graph (DAG) structure, which allows for faster transaction speeds, lower fees, and enhanced scalability. This innovative approach has led many to ask, "Is Hedera legit?" The answer lies in its governance model and partnerships.

Hedera is governed by a council of global enterprises, including Google, IBM, and Boeing, which ensures decentralization and transparency. This governance structure is a key factor in establishing trust and legitimacy within the cryptocurrency community. Additionally, HBar, the native token of Hedera, is used for transaction fees, staking, and securing the network.

Hedera Economic Model and Tokenomics

The economic model of Hedera revolves around the utility of HBar. With a fixed supply of 50 billion tokens, HBar is designed to maintain scarcity while supporting the network's operations. The tokenomics of HBar are structured to incentivize both developers and users, ensuring a sustainable ecosystem.

HBar is used to pay for transaction fees on the Hedera network, which are significantly lower than those of traditional blockchain platforms. This cost efficiency makes Hedera an attractive option for enterprises and developers. Furthermore, HBar holders can stake their tokens to participate in network consensus, earning rewards in the process. This staking mechanism not only secures the network but also provides an additional use case for the token.
